What is the Role of an Industrial Sales Executive?
An Industrial Sales Executive plays a pivotal role in driving the growth of industrial companies by identifying and securing business opportunities. They are the front-liners who interact with potential clients, understand their needs, and offer tailored solutions that meet those needs. Their role is not just about selling; it’s about building relationships, understanding market trends, and contributing to product development based on customer feedback.
Industrial Sales Executives navigate through complex sales cycles, negotiate contracts, and close deals that are mutually beneficial. They work closely with various departments within the organization, such as marketing, production, and customer service, to ensure that the client’s expectations are met and exceeded.
What are the Industrial Sales Executive Job Requirements?
Becoming an Industrial Sales Executive requires a combination of education, experience, and skills. Here are the basic requirements for this role:
- A bachelor’s degree in Business, Marketing, Engineering, or a related field.
- Proven experience in sales, preferably in the industrial sector.
- Strong understanding of market dynamics and customer requirements.
- Excellent communication, negotiation, and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
- Willingness to travel frequently to meet clients and attend trade shows.
Additional certifications in sales or marketing can enhance the credibility of an Industrial Sales Executive and open up more opportunities for career advancement.
What are the Responsibilities of an Industrial Sales Executive?
The responsibilities of an Industrial Sales Executive are diverse and challenging. They are the bridge between the company and its clients, ensuring that both parties’ needs and expectations are aligned. Here are some of the key responsibilities:
- Identifying and targeting potential clients through market research, networking, and cold calling.
- Developing and maintaining relationships with existing clients to ensure repeat business.
- Understanding clients’ needs and proposing customized solutions to meet those needs.
- Negotiating contracts and closing deals while ensuring client satisfaction.
- Working closely with other departments to ensure product availability and timely delivery.
- Attending trade shows and conferences to stay updated on industry trends and to network with potential clients.
- Providing feedback to the product development team based on client requirements and market trends.

Industrial Sales Executive Resume Writing Tips
Creating a standout resume is crucial for an Industrial Sales Executive. It’s your personal marketing tool that showcases your skills, experience, and achievements. Here are some tips to help you craft a compelling resume:
- Highlight your sales achievements, including specific deals closed, revenue generated, and targets achieved.
- Detail your experience in the industrial sector, showcasing your knowledge of the market and products.
- Include any sales or marketing certifications you have earned.
- Emphasize your communication and negotiation skills through specific examples.
- Customize your resume for the specific role you are applying for, aligning your skills and experience with the job requirements.

Industrial Sales Executive Resume Summary Examples
Your resume summary is a snapshot of your professional journey. It should highlight your key achievements, skills, and value proposition. Here are some examples to guide you:
- “Results-driven Industrial Sales Executive with over 5 years of experience in cultivating client relationships and exceeding sales targets. Proven ability to identify business opportunities and drive revenue growth.”
- “Dynamic and motivated Industrial Sales Executive with a track record of generating multimillion-dollar sales in the industrial sector. Expertise in market analysis, client needs assessment, and contract negotiation.”
- “Proactive Industrial Sales Executive with a flair for building lasting client relationships and closing high-value deals. Adept at navigating complex sales cycles and proposing tailored industrial solutions.”
Each summary should be a reflection of your unique sales journey, highlighting your achievements and skills.
Create a Strong Experience Section for Your Industrial Sales Executive Resume
The experience section is the core of your resume. It should detail your sales journey, highlighting your roles, responsibilities, and achievements. Here are some examples:
- “Secured a $5 million deal with a leading manufacturing company, resulting in a 20% increase in annual revenue.”
- “Developed and maintained relationships with 50+ clients, ensuring repeat business and client satisfaction.”
- “Conducted market research to identify potential clients, resulting in a 30% increase in client acquisition.”
- “Collaborated with the product development team to customize products based on client requirements, enhancing product appeal and customer satisfaction.”
Each experience listed should showcase your contribution to the company’s success and your growth as a sales professional.

Most Common Mistakes to Avoid When Writing an Industrial Sales Executive Resume
While crafting your resume, it’s essential to avoid common mistakes that can hinder your chances of landing the job. Here are some mistakes to watch out for:
- Using a generic resume for all job applications.
- Focusing on job duties rather than achievements.
- Ignoring the importance of a customized cover letter.
- Including irrelevant information or personal details.
- Failing to proofread for typos and grammatical errors.
